Subspecies
Considered by some authors to be a subspecies of Pale-legged Hornero (Furnarius leucopus).
The following 2 subspecies are recognised:
longirostris Pelzeln, 1856 - Northern Colombia (Córdoba east to lower Magdalena Valley) and north-western Venezuela (north-western Zulia east to western Falcón, north-western Lara and Carabobo).
endoecus Cory, 1919 - Northern Colombia (lower and middle Magdalena Valley) and western Venezuela (southern Zulia).
